Westerkamp","submitted_at":"2006-02-24T16:53:52Z","abstract_excerpt":"CePd_1-xRh_x alloys exhibit a continuous evolution from ferromagnetism (T_C= 6.5 K) at x = 0 to a mixed valence (MV) state at x = 1. We have performed a detailed investigation on the suppression of the ferromagnetic (F) phase in this alloy using dc-(\\chi_dc) and ac-susceptibility (\\chi_ac), specific heat (C_m), resistivity (\\rho) and thermal expansion (\\beta) techniques. Our results show a continuous decrease of T_C (x) with negative curvature down to T_C = 3K at x*= 0.65, where a positive curvature takes over.
